About 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ane
3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ane (PubChem CID 67894336) has the molecular formula C22H33F3O6S
and a molecular weight of 482.56 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ane.

What is the SMILES notation for 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ane?
The canonical SMILES for 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ane is C1CCC(OC2CCCCO2)OC1.CC(C)(O)C(CS(=O)(=O)c1ccccc1)C(F)(F)F.
What is the InChIKey of 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ane?
The InChIKey is XCMBHTJDQGGMIS-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C12H15F3O3S.C10H18O3/c1-11(2,16)10(12(13,14)15)8-19(17,18)9-6-4-3-5-7-9;1-3-7-11-9(5-1)13-10-6-2-4-8-12-10/h3-7,10,16H,8H2,1-2H3;9-10H,1-8H2.
What are the key properties of 3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ane?
3-(benzenesulfonylmethyl)-4,4,4-trifluoro-2-methylbutan-2-ol;2-(oxan-2-yloxy)oxane has a molecular weight of 482.56 g/mol, XLogP of 4.47, 6 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
